The Hammond Redevelopment Commission meeting on October 1, 2024, focused on several procurement and contracting matters related to community development and housing. The commission reviewed and approved forgivable loans under the Homebound Program for two applicants, each receiving $2,500 to support homeownership. They authorized advertising for professional services including appraisers, environmental consultants, financial consultants, housing services consultants, HUD IDIS consultants, and redevelopment attorneys to support ongoing redevelopment efforts. Additionally, the commission authorized advertising for funding requests related to Community Development Block Grant (CDBG), Emergency Solutions Grant (ESG), and Community Housing Development Organization (CHDO) programs for fiscal year 2025. Other agenda items included approval of an intergovernmental agreement for liquor license transfer and authorization for soil sampling related to a potential property purchase. Public comments highlighted the positive impact of redevelopment programs on residents and community safety events were announced. Overall, the meeting emphasized contracting and budget allocations to support housing and community development initiatives in Hammond, Indiana.
